Birds In Row

Birds In Row are a French post-hardcore punk band who shroud themselves i secrecy.  They only go by their first initials and do not allow photos of their faces to be taken.  That's cool i guess, but more importantly, they've got a really excellent, moody, and aggressive sound going for them.  Listen to "15-38" below and pre-order the upcoming "We Already Lost the World" LP here from Deathwish.

Thou

Baton Rouge sludge metal band Thou are looking to have a very, very, very busy summer, having already released a droney, noisy mess of an EP earlier this month with "The House Primordial," a new EP, the dark and acoustic-centric "Inconsolable," drops officially tomorrow.  But that's not all!  The band also has a third EP on the way in July called "Rhea Sylvia" which the band describes as melodic grunge, a kind of Alice In Chains homage.  But that's still not all!  August will see the release of the band's fifth full-length of what is sure to be a crushing colossus of doom called "Magus."  Stream "Inconsolable" below, download it here, and pre-order the vinyl here from Community Records.



Then, listen to "The Only Law" from "Rhea Sylvia," pre-order the download here, and pre-order the vinyl here from Deathwish Inc.



And finally, listen to "The Changeling Prince" from "Magus," pre-order the download here, and pre-order the vinyl here from Sacred Bones.

Wovenhand

I had never heard of Denver band Wovenhand until about a month ago, just as snippets and tastes of the group's new album "Refractory Obdurate" were starting to surface on various blogs...and whoa, have i been missing out on something spectacular.  The band started as an offshoot of alt-country act 16 Horsepower, and have been churning out records for the last 13 years or so.  The band blends the aforementioned alt-country with gloomy folk, elements of ragged Americana, experimental metal, blues stomp, post, prog, and punk rock, and an old school vibe akin to channeling the Druids or ancient mystics.  In short, it's an absolutely amazing record.  Fans of Swans will be swimming in this...and you should too.  Get the album from Deathwish Inc, and listen to "Good Shepard" below.
